To ensure the best conditions for the exam, the school organized it at 4 locations: Cau Giay Secondary School, Yen Hoa Secondary School, Tran Duy Hung Secondary School, Nguyen Viet Xuan Elementary School.
Talking to a reporter from Lao Dong Newspaper, Ms. Nguyen Thi Mai - Vice Principal of Cau Giay Secondary School said: "In the enrollment season of the 2026 - 2027 school year, the school organizes a competency assessment test for students. With an enrollment target of 440 students, while the number of registered candidates is 5,656, we organize tests at 4 exam sites with a scale of 189 exam rooms.

The number of registered applications this year has increased sharply compared to last year. Explaining this issue, Ms. Nguyen Thi Mai said "In previous years, the school limited the subjects of enrollment registration to students who actually registered their residence in Cau Giay district. This year, when implementing the two-level local government model, the school does not limit the area of residence. Just having residence in Hanoi, students can all participate in registering for enrollment at Cau Giay Secondary School. Therefore, the number of applications this year has increased significantly compared to last year. If the school received more than 3,000 applications last year, this number has exceeded 5,000 applications this year.

Regarding this year's exam questions, the school said that it has made it very clear in the enrollment plan and in the process of propaganda to parents and students.
The content of the exam questions mainly focuses on the 5th grade program according to the 2018 General Education Program. The exam questions combine both multiple-choice and essay forms so that students can develop their abilities and complete the exam," said Vice Principal Nguyen Thi Mai.

Student's GPA score = GPA score for Math subject + GPA score for Vietnamese subject + GPA score for English subject Admission score = GPA score + admission score (if any).


The enrollment principle of Cau Giay Secondary School is to only recruit students who meet the enrollment conditions and participate in 3 competency assessment tests, without violating the Regulations in the competency assessment period to the extent of canceling the assessment results.
Admission scores are considered from high to low until the quota is met, the benchmark score for the school is calculated as the score of the last student according to the quota.
Cau Giay Secondary School announces time milestones parents need to pay attention to
Results announcement schedule (June 15, 2026)
Parents look up GDNL results of students on the school's enrollment website.
Submit a re-examination application (June 15 - June 16, 2026) Parents submit a re-examination application (if they wish) on the school's admissions website.
Collect admission documents (June 18 - June 19, 2026) Submit original documents as prescribed: Original primary school transcript. Certified copy of the following documents: Birth certificate; Certificate of priority status issued by competent authority (if any); Legal basis for confirming residence information. Student's account code and password (primary school issued). 01 3x4 student ID card photo (clearly state full name and date of birth after photo).
Announcing the re-examination results (June 22, 2026) Parents can look up the re-examination results of GNL of students at the school's enrollment website or at the registered email.
